We are seeking a highly motivated Technical Solutions Writer who thrives in a fast-paced federal contracting environment. The ideal candidate plays a critical role in translating complex technical solutions into clear, compelling processes and narratives that align with requirements and resonate with government clients. This role requires a positive, collaborative professional with strong time management skills, flexibility, and a solutions-oriented mindset.

Successful candidates take ownership of their assignments, adapt quickly to changing priorities, and consistently deliver high-quality work under compressed timelines and pressure.

Responsibilities
  • Support client programs by gathering, analyzing, and synthesizing technical, operational, and programmatic information to develop clear, accurate documentation and deliverables.
  • Collaborate with technical SMEs, operations stakeholders, and solution architects to document system functionality, processes, and project outcomes in a way that supports client understanding and mission success.
  • Translate complex technical concepts into clear, concise, and actionable content for both technical and non-technical audiences, including clients, leadership, and end users.
  • Demonstrate capability to conceptualize graphics that capture and communicate complex technical solutions.
  • Develop and maintain high-quality program documentation such as standard operating procedures (SOPs), user guides, process documentation, reports, and briefings.
  • Identify gaps, risks, or unclear elements in technical approaches or program execution and work with stakeholders to clarify and strengthen deliverables.
  • Support project teams by creating structured, compelling narratives that communicate program value, performance, and outcomes to the client.
  • Assist with development of presentations, briefings, dashboards, and other materials that support client engagement.
  • Maintain organized knowledge repositories, including program documentation, lessons learned, and reusable content to improve delivery efficiency and consistency.
  • Participate in internal and client-facing meetings to capture requirements, document decisions, and ensure alignment across stakeholders.
  • Provide guidance on documentation quality, clarity, and consistency across project deliverables.
  • Demonstrate a proactive, solutions-oriented mindset in a fast-paced environment, supporting evolving client needs and priorities.
  • Support capture and proposal efforts by gathering technical input, conducting SME interviews, and developing compliant, persuasive written responses.
  • Translate proposed technical solutions into clear narratives aligned with solicitation requirements.
  • Lead proposal sections, RFIs, white papers, and pre-solicitation artifacts.
  • Maintain and update reusable proposal content, including past performance, management approaches, and technical solution descriptions.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in technical writing, information systems, engineering, computer science, or a related discipline.
  • 8+ years of experience supporting federal government programs or contracts.
  • 5+ years of experience in technical writing, program documentation, or proposal development.
    • Experience supporting highly technical environments (IT, cybersecurity, systems engineering, etc.) strongly preferred.
    • Proposal writing experience for federal solicitations preferred.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with exceptional attention to detail.
  • Ability to translate complex technical information into clear, client-ready documentation and deliverables.
  •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to engage effectively with SMEs, project teams, and client stakeholders.
  • Strong time management and organ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a dynamic environment.
  • Experience developing presentations, reports, SOPs, and other structured documentation.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and Adobe Acrobat.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ality of sensitive information.
  • Demonstrated ability to perform effectively in a high-tempo, deadline-driven environment.
  • Positive, collaborative mindset with a focus on delivering high-quality outcomes for both client and internal teams.
